Git学习之多人协作


多人协作时,从远程克隆时,默认情况下,只能看到master分支
git checkout -b dev origin/dev创建远程origin的dev分支到本地
git branch --set-upstream-to=origin/dev dev建立本地分支与远程分支的关联


多人协作时,
① 试图用 git push origin <branch_name> 推送修改
② 失败,则因为远程分支比你的本地更新,试图git pull 合并
③ 有冲突,则解决冲突,并提交,再push
④ 没有冲突,用git push origin <branch_name>

例如:
D:\GitRepository\pythonwork 修改了readme.txt, 并且push
G:\pythonwork 也修改了 readme.txt, 并且push

Git学习之多人协作

Git学习之多人协作

Git学习之多人协作